Yea , and a tube of dielectric grease. Coat the entire inside of the boots. If your friend disagrees , you better do it yourself





If you need the procedure - PM me w/ you email address and I'll send it to yuh.


Don't over torque anything / Specially the plugs. No more than 16' lbs.

The COP's as well, they ride on a bushing and are suppose to be loose -
